Definitions
- the invention relates to the technical sector of skylights for overhead lighting and / or smoke extraction from buildings.
- a skylight consists essentially of a dome made of material transparent, translucent or opaque, made integral with a frame articulated by a fixed or curb frame.
- the skylight has a very general shape substantially square or rectangular, in opposition to the vaults of generally linear form.
- the dome In the case of a skylight, the dome, through its frame, is articulated relative to one of the edges of the curb to the means actuators, so that it can be opened beyond an angle of 90 °, and generally at an angle of about 140 °.
- the command to open or close the dome by one central jack whose barrel is articulated on a crossmember fixed very substantially along the median axis of the curb.
- the cylinder rod is articulated at its free end, on a cross member secured to the frame receiving the dome.
- This opening and closing system can be doubled, so that the articulation of the dome with respect to the curb is effected by means of two cylinders arranged on each side of the curb and the dome, and in two parallel planes.
- the opening of the dome with respect to the curb must be made at an angle of approximately 140 °. It is therefore necessary to provide mechanical or other means to secure the dome in the maximum open position.
- a jack which incorporates in its operating a mechanical locking system.
- the mounting of the or control cylinders can be combined with a cylinder system gas and / or with rod systems arranged at each end of the articulation of the dome with respect to the curb. So it is necessary to provide special means limiting the opening of the dome by compared to the curb.
- this type of opening which is effected by articulation of the dome in relation to one of the edges of the curb, poses real problems to automatically close the dome, when this the latter is in the open position of approximately 140 °. Again, it's very often necessary to use means to initiate this closing movement.
- teaching FR-A-2,542,360 and 2,678,307 which disclose one and the other the use of a cable system of the stop in position maximum opening and a spring system capable of facilitating the closing of the dome.
- the articulation of the dome relative to one of the edges of the rooflight curb poses real technical problems, account due in particular to the fact that it must be able to be kept in position opening, at an angle greater than 90 ° and generally of the order of 140 °. Other wind catching problems may also appear.
- the object of the invention is to remedy these drawbacks, simple, safe, efficient and rational way.
- the problem which the invention proposes to solve is to ensure the opening of the dome in relation to the curb, no longer so articulated with respect to one of the edges of said curb, but ensuring the opening and closing of said dome in a plane parallel to the plane base defined by the curb.
- an important problem which the invention proposes to solve is to be able to integrate the actuator member in particular in the form of a cylinder, inside the space defined by the curb avoiding any overflow of the cylinder barrel in particular, in the open position and in the closed from the dome.
- the skylight designated as a whole by (L) includes a curb (1) and a dome or dome (2) generally integral with a frame (3).
- the construction arrangements for the entire skylight are not are not described in detail, as they may have different shapes execution.
- the dome (2) is fixed peripherally of sealingly between two wings of a frame (4) made integral with the frame (3) of said dome.
- the curb (1) which defines the general shape of the skylight, has a section, plan view, very substantially square or rectangular.
- the dome (2) is articulated with respect to the curb (1) by means of a device which allows an opening of said dome in a plane substantially parallel to the plane basic general defined by the curb, so that the dome (2) is moved vertically and no longer angularly relative to one of the sides of the curb according to previous techniques.
- the device comprises at least a system of two articulated arms arranged in a cross (A) and (B). At least one of the arms (A) is attached to an actuating member (5) to allow articulation of the cross corresponding to the opening or closing position of the dome by compared to the curb.
- One end of the arm (A) is mounted with the capacity to displacement and articulation in a light (6a) that presents a part fixed (6) of the curb.
- the other end of the arm (A) is articulated with a fixed linear position on a fixed part (7) of the dome.
- Let (A1) and (A2) the articulation axes of the arm (A) respectively with respect to the light (6a) and the fixed part (7).
- One end of the other arm (B) is articulated with a fixed linear position, on the fixed part (6) of the curb.
- the other end of the arm (B) is mounted with the capacity to displacement and articulation in a light (7a) that presents the part fixed (7) of the dome.
- (B1) and (B2) be the axes of articulation respectively at the level of the fixed part (6) of the curb, and of the light (7a) of the fixed part (7) of the dome.
- the two arms (A) and (B) are of equal length, thus allowing the vertical opening of the entire dome (2) in a parallel plane to the base plane defined by the curb (1).
- the actuator member (5) is a double-acting cylinder, the barrel (5a) of which is articulated with a fixed linear position, at a determined location in the part fixed (6) of the curb. Let (5a1) this axis of articulation.
- the free end (5b1) of the rod (5b) of the jack is articulated with a fixed angular position on the arm (A) for example.
- the actuator member (5) can also be present in the form of a gas spring of any known and appropriate type.
- the cylinder (5) has the effect of "motorizing" the system of two articulated arms arranged in a cross (A) and (B), allowing thus ensuring a good distribution of the forces necessary for displacement of the dome in relation to the curb.
- the combined mounting of the cylinder (5) relative to one of the arms (A) or (B) allows the integration of said cylinder with respect to the cross system (A) and (B), so that the barrel (5a) does not not extend beyond the lower base plane of the curb (1), as well open position than closed position of the dome ( Figures 2 and 3).
- the jack (5) is arranged angularly relative to the arm (A) according to an angle ( ⁇ ) of between 10 ° and 30 ° approximately.
- each of the two arms (A) and (B) consists of two parallel flat bars (8-9) and (10-11).
- the cylinder (5) is arranged between the two flat bars (8) and (9) constituting the arm (A).
- the device includes a single cross arm system (A) and (B).
- the fixed part of the curb consists of a crosspiece (6) arranged at the lower base plane of said curb, and very substantially in its middle part.
- the fixed part (7) of the dome is also consisting of a crosspiece arranged in the bracing position of the two opposite sides of the frame (3), in its middle part.

Claims (6)
- Dispositif d'articulation d'une coupole (2) sur une costière (1) de lanterneau, au moyen d'au moins un système de deux bras articulés disposés en croix (A) et (B), pour permettre l'ouverture et la fermeture de la coupole dans un plan parallèle à celui défini par la costière, au moyen d'un vérin double effet (5), caractérisé en ce que le fût (Sa) du vérin (5) est articulé avec une position linéaire fixe à une partie fixe (6) de la costière (1) recevant, à libre articulation, l'une des extrémités des bras (A) et (B) disposés en croix, l'extrémité libre de la tige (5b) dudit vérin (5) étant articulée avec une position linéaire fixe, sur l'un desdits bras (A).
- Dispositif selon la revendication 1, caractérisé en ce que chaque bras (A) et (B) est constitué par deux fers plats parallèles (8-9) et (10-11), le vérin étant disposé entre les deux fers du bras correspondant.
- Dispositif selon la revendication 1, caractérisé en ce que le vérin (5) est disposé angulairement par rapport au bras (A) auquel il est accouplé, selon un angle (α) compris entre 10° et 30° environ.
- Dispositif selon la revendication 1, caractérisé en ce que l'une des extrémités de l'un des bras (A) est montée avec capacité de déplacement et d'articulation dans une lumière (6a) que présente la partie fixe (6) de la costière (1), son autre extrémité étant articulée, avec une position linéaire fixe, sur la partie fixe (7) de la coupole (1), tandis que l'une des extrémités de l'autre bras (B) est articulée, avec une position linéaire fixe, sur la partie fixe (6) de la costière (1), son autre extrémité étant montée avec capacité de déplacement et d'articulation dans une lumière (7a) que présente la partie fixe (7) de la coupole (2).
- Dispositif selon la revendication 1, caractérisé en ce qu'il comprend un système de bras en croix (A) et (B) articulés sur des traverses disposées dans la partie médiane de la costière (1) et d'un cadre (3) recevant la coupole (2).
- Dispositif selon la revendication 1, caractérisé en ce qu'il comprend deux systèmes de bras en croix (A) et (B) articulés au niveau des bords latéraux ou transversaux de la costière (1) et d'un cadre (3) recevant la coupole (2).
